The first edition of Ludicious Zurich Game Festival will turn the town into the computer game industry meeting point for innovative emerging talents. Also a varied programme will be offered for interested members of the public. Special highlights of the three-day festival include the awards for the festivals International Competition and Student Competition. In addition the Swiss Game Developers Association (SGDA) will present the Swiss Game Award during the festival. The opening of the third Call for Projects: Swiss Games 2014/2015 of the Swiss Arts Council Pro Helvetia will form a further highlight.
